| ServiceMix Documentation |
| ======================== |
| |
| Overview |
| -------- |
| The documentation is written in the Asciidoctor format, and processed using the Maven Asciidoctor plugin. |
| |
| Building the documentation project |
| ---------------------------------- |
| `mvn clean install` will build the documentation and create a static website in `target/generated-docs`. |
| |
| The build process will also create files for all Karaf commands based on the correct Karaf version defined in the pom file. It |
| appears that the Karaf manual is no longer deployed as a Maven artifact to the central repository. Consequently, no copy of the user |
| and developmemt guides are included in this documentation. Instead, the link to the current Karaf documentation is provided. |
| |
| Publishing the documentation to the website |
| ------------------------------------------- |
| If you're an Apache ServiceMix committer, you can publish a new copy of the documentation pages with this command: |
| `mvn clean install scm-publish:publish-scm` |
